Subsidiary Scholarship Initiatives
The details of the subsidiary scholarships are as follows:-
Scholarship | Form Of Benefit | Beneficiaries | Amount of Benefit |
Umbrella Scheme For Education Of St Children – Pre-Matric Scholarship (Class Ix & X) For St Students – Meghalaya | Scholarships will be given to the students belonging to the ST communities | Students of classes from 9th and 10th | Scholars = Rs. 150/- Per Month Hosteller = Rs. 350/- Per Month |
Umbrella Scheme For Education Of St Children – Post-Matric Scholarship (Pms) For St Students – Meghalaya | Students of ST communities will be given the scholarship amounts | Students of classes 11th to further | On the basis of groups |
Scholarship For Pre-Service Student Teacher Under D.El.Ed Course-Meghalaya | Teachers will be given the scholarship amounts | Students who have passed class 12th | Variable |
STSE For Tribal Students(Class Ix And X) In Mathematics And Science Award-Meghalaya | Students of ST communities will be given the scholarship amounts | Students of classes 9th and 10th | Rs. 600/- Per Month |
Award For Meritorious Tribal Student- HSSLC Science-Meghalaya | Scholarships will be given to the students belonging to the ST communities | Students of class 12th | Rs. 10,000/- |
Centrally Sponsored Scheme Of Pre Matric Scholarship For Sc Students (Class Ix & X) -Meghalaya | Students of SC communities will be given the scholarship amounts | Students of classes from 9th and 10th | Scholars = Rs. 225/- Monthly Hosteller = Rs. 525/- Monthly |
Centrally Sponsored Scheme Of Post Matric Scholarship For Sc Students-Meghalaya | Scholarships will be given to the students belonging to the SC communities | Students of classes 11th to further | Variable Assistance |
Ishan Uday Scholarship for NER | Scholarships will be provided to the students from NER states | Students undertaking general degree courses, and technical/professional courses | Rs. 5,400/- to Rs. 7,800/- |
Group Wise Classification Of Courses
The details of covered courses under each group are as follows:-
Group | Courses |
Group I | UG/ PG (Medicine, Engineering, Technology, Planning, Architecture, Fashion Technology, Management, Business, Finance Administration, Computer Science, Agriculture, Allied Sciences)Diploma Level Courses |
Group II | Professional Courses Diploma Course Certificate Courses B.Pharma LLB BFS Para Medical Studies Mass Communication Hotel Management & Catering Tourism Hospitality Interior Decoration Commercial Art Banking Services |
Group III | UG Courses |
Group IV | Non-Degree Courses Vocational Course ITI Courses 3 Year Diploma Polytechnic Courses |
Group Wise Scholarship Amount
The details of the scholarship amount provided to each group are as follows:-
Group | Courses | Scholarship Amount |
Group I | UG/ PG (Medicine, Engineering, Technology, Planning, Architecture, Fashion Technology, Management, Business, Finance Administration, Computer Science, Agriculture, Allied Sciences)Diploma Level Courses | Scholar = Rs. 550/- per month Hosteller = Rs. 1200/- per month |
Group II | Professional Courses Diploma Course Certificate Courses B.Pharma LLB BFS Para Medical Studies Mass Communication Hotel Management & Catering Tourism Hospitality Interior Decoration Commercial Art Banking Services | Scholar = Rs. 530/- per month Hosteller = Rs. 820/- per month |
Group III | UG Courses | Scholar = Rs. 300/- per month Hosteller = 570/- per month |
Group IV | Non-Degree Courses Vocational Course ITI Courses 3 Year Diploma Polytechnic Courses | Scholar = Rs. 230/- per month Hosteller = Rs. 380/- |
Reader Allowance For Blind Students
The reader allowance offered to blind students are as follows:-
Group | Reader Allowance |
Group I | Rs. 240/- per month |
Group II | Rs. 240/- per month |
Group III | Rs. 200/- per month |
Group IV | Rs. 160/- per month |

Age Limit (Scholarship For Pre-Service Student Teacher Under D.El.Ed Course-Meghalaya)
Candidates who are going to undertake a Diploma in Elementary Education will need to possess the age limit fixed by the selection body. The selection body has fixed the age limit from 18 to 27 years. Age relaxation will be provided to the beneficiary categories such as SC, ST, OBC and PWD for 5 years.

Eligibility Criteria
The applicants who want to apply online under this scholarship are as follows:-
Scholarship | Eligibility Criteria |
Umbrella Scheme For Education Of St Children – Pre-Matric Scholarship (Class Ix & X) For St Students – Meghalaya | The student must hold the domicile of Meghalaya and must be pursuing classes 9th and 10th and have an annual income limit of Rs. 2.50 lakhs. |
Umbrella Scheme For Education Of St Children – Post-Matric Scholarship (Pms) For St Students – Meghalaya | The student must belong to the ST community and must be pursuing classes from the 11th onwards and have an annual income limit of Rs. 2.50 lakhs. |
Scholarship For Pre-Service Student Teacher Under D.El.Ed Course-Meghalaya | The candidate must have passed class 12th with 50% marks and now he or she must be pursuing a Diploma in Elementary Education falling under the age group from 18 to 27 years. |
STSE For Tribal Students(Class Ix And X) In Mathematics And Science Award-Meghalaya | The student must belong to the ST category and must be pursuing classes 9th and 10th while securing 50% marks in the Maths and Science subject in the class 7th from the recognized school. |
Award For Meritorious Tribal Student- HSSLC Science-Meghalaya | The ST student must have secured good marks in the 12th exam and must belong to the areas such as Khasi, Jaintia, Garo, Koch and Hajong. |
Centrally Sponsored Scheme Of Pre Matric Scholarship For Sc Students (Class Ix & X) -Meghalaya | The student must be pursuing classes 9th and 10th belonging to the SC category and having an annual parental income of Rs. 2,50,000/-. |
Centrally Sponsored Scheme Of Post Matric Scholarship For Sc Students-Meghalaya | This scholarship will be provided to the students of SC who must be pursuing post-matric classes and must possess an annual income of Rs. 2,50,000/-. |
ISHAN UDAY Scholarship For NER | The student must belong to NER states such as Assam, Arunachal Pradesh, Manipur, Meghalaya, Mizoram, Nagaland & Tripura pursuing General Courses, Professional and Vocational courses having an annual income limit of Rs. 4,50,000/-. |
Important Documents
Some of the important documents to apply online under the Meghalaya Scholarship are as follows:-
- Aadhar Card
- PAN Card
- Income certificate
- Educational Certificate
- Caste Certificate
- Residence certificate/ Domicile Certificate
- Proof of bank account details
- Latest Passport size photograph of the applicant
- Self-Declaration form
- Course fee receipt
- Meghalaya Scholarship Application Form
- Non-judicial stamp paper
